On October 31st when the sun goes down and every thing’s “wonderfully cold and dark” vampire boy Bela wakes and, with his little witch friend Morgan, climbs on a broomstick and flies into the night in search of elusive creatures known as “children.” What they find just might surprise them this Halloween Night!

Each page of this charming gothic tale is filled, corner to corner, with beautifully rich images.  I love that he has his own Butler! What Bat boy doesn’t? And the colors used in the illustrations are so vibrant, any child will love gazing at these pictures as they read along!

This is one of my favorite pages in the book! Your children will discover the whimsical details created by Lisa Brown – from the books strewn about Bela’s bedroom to witches feet poking out the bottom of Morgan’s house – the clever illustrations will draw readers back time and again to relive Bela and Morgan’s adventure in VAMPIRE BOY’S GOOD NIGHT.

It’s not too spooky so don’t fret too much kiddies, But is isn’t so sweet either! So bewareeeee. Muahhahaha. That’s my spooky laugh.

Publisher’s Weekly,  gave Vampire Boy’s Good Night a starred review:  “The lyrical, understated prose and clever outsider’s perspective on the holiday might make this a new seasonal favorite.” I’m certain it will as well!
